DESCRIPTION:Title: Multi-factor Approach for Flaky Test Detection and Automated Root Cause Analysis \nSpeaker: Azeem Ahmad\, Linköping University \nAbstract:  Re-running test cases is the most popular and adopted approach to detect flaky test in large scale industries. Re-running is costly because it consumes a lot of computing power. Google uses 2-16% of its testing budget just to re-run flaky tests. Re-running is unreliable because it is hard to determine the number of re-runs to find discrepancy in output. We developed\, implemented and evaluated multi-factor approach to detect flaky test without re-running. The contributed factors are (1) number of test smells in the test cases\, (2) whether test case failed after executing on the corresponding change in production code\, (3) test case history\, and (4) test case size. The machine learning algorithm is implemented to find relationships between the contributed factors and the possibility of test flakiness. Once the build is failed\, our tool can determine whether the failed test case is a real failure or flaky.

DESCRIPTION:Most welcome to a workshop on ’Data pricing’ which we run as part of the PdM community workshop series. \nLocation:\nHybrid event (On-site at Lindholmen and online using Microsoft Teams) \nBackground:\nOften\, data is described as the “new oil” and very recently it was described as an “anti-commodity” in a presentation highlighting the potential of data to reshape and redefine business models and revenue streams. For companies\, there are a number of ways in which to exploit data: \n\nData is used to generate benefits within the organization and within the scope of the company\nData is shared with others to generate benefits that are non-monetary but instead indirectly monetizable and related to e.g. risk\, warranty etc.\nData is sold with monetary reimbursement\n\nFocus:\nIn this workshop\, we explore how the participating companies create and exploit value out of the data they collect from products in the field in (1) monetary and/or non-monetary ways and for (2)interorganizational use and/or external use. It is organized especially for product managers as part of the PdM community workshop series and with the intention to have the companies exchange knowledge and best practices. \nBACKGROUND\nBusiness agility is critical for companies across domains as it involves the ability to quickly respond to market dynamics and to emerging technologies. While business agility\, and agile practices as its enabler\, has predominantly been associated with the software industry it is rapidly becoming key for companies in the embedded systems industry. \nHowever\, the adoption of agile practices is fundamentally different in embedded systems companies compared to software companies. For embedded systems companies\, business agility requires all parts of the system to be agile\, including traditional technologies such as mechanics and electronics as well as digital technologies such as software\, data and AI. \nDue to this\, agility means different things for the different technologies involved and for an embedded systems company business agility is achieved when having (1) identified the optimal level of agility for each technology. \nMoreover\, while traditional technologies have so far been monetized using transactional business models\, digital technologies allow for continuous business models in which frequent improvements of system functionality makes systems improve throughout their economic life. This means that business agility is achieved when (2) the transactional business models are complemented\, or replaced with\, with models that enable continuous value capture of these technologies. \nRegistration: Please send an e-mail to helena.holmstrom.olsson@mau.se if you are interested in participating
